Reporting to the Group Quality Manager, the Asbestos Technical Manager will be responsible for the managing and maintaining the company’s UKAS accreditation to ISO17025 and ISO17020.

The Job Role

  • Ensuring that all employees within the Asbestos Division adhere to the asbestos technical procedures, through the review of audits and training needs.
  • Managing the technical audit schedule to ensure that employee authorisations are maintained.
  • Providing confirmation of authorisation status of technical staff, and maintenance of skills matrix
  • Managing and maintaining the QA process for inspection and testing activities (re-surveys, stage 2 checks, and desktop reviews of 4SC).
  • The design, delivery and review of technical training activities (toolbox, annual refresher etc.)
  • Supervision and training of trainee technical staff when necessary
  • The supervision of the technical assessor during UKAS visits, and assist with the close out of any technical related UKAS findings
  • The investigation of nonconformances relating to inspection and testing activities.
  • Monitoring the performance and standards of technical auditors.
  • Completion of site-based technical audits as required.
  • Assisting in the onboarding and induction of new staff, including trainee and qualified staff, and responsible for timely feedback and decision making during the probationary review period
  • Managing and maintaining up to date equipment records.
  • Completing calibrations and arranging external maintenance/servicing activities
  • Managing internal QC schemes (fibre counting and bulk sample analysis) and external proficiency testing schemes (RICE and AIMS)
  • Purchasing and managing consumables.

About You

  • Relevant experience working within the industry, preferably in a technical role.
  • Minimum P401. P402, P403, P404 (or equivalent) or Certificate of Competence in Asbestos.
  • Previous experience within each discipline would be an advantage (bulk analysis, surveying and analytical).
  • Excellent communication and leadership skills.
